Sydney | Full-time | Hybrid – 2–3 days in our Sydney, Leichhardt office 

 

What you will love about this role:

At 3P Learning, our people are the heartbeat behind everything we do. Our award-winning products Mathletics, Reading Eggs, Mathseeds and Writing Legends, reach millions of students and educators across the globe, and none of that happens without the talented, passionate people who build, support, and champion them every day.

As our People & Culture Advisor – APAC, you’ll join a cohesive and high performing global People & Culture team, as the go-to person for managers and employees alike in the APAC region. You’ll be the engine behind a seamless, engaging employee experience across our APAC region of around 200 people. From recruitment and onboarding through to performance, wellbeing, and compliance, you’ll work closely with the Heads of People & Culture, and key contacts in the APAC region, to deliver the People and Culture agenda.

Reporting to the Head of People & Culture, and based in Australia, we’re open to hybrid working from our Sydney office. If you’re a people person who loves variety, thrives on building relationships, and wants a role where your work is visible and your impact real, this one’s for you.

What you will do: 

  • Act as a trusted advisor to managers and employees across the APAC region, providing guidance and support across all stages of the employee lifecycle recruitment, onboarding, performance, development, employee engagement and offboarding.
  • Lead end-to-end recruitment activity in region: partner with hiring managers to shape role profiles, screen and interview candidates, guide fair and inclusive selection decisions, conduct reference and background checks, and prepare employment contracts.
  • Ensure a seamless and engaging onboarding experience for new starters, owning the P&C collateral and processes that set people up to thrive from day one.
  • Serve as the first point of contact for people-related queries, offering informed, solutions-focused advice on performance management, employee relations, wellbeing, and workplace legislation.
  • Support and coach managers on best practices and employee relations matters, including application of the Fair Work Act, National Employment Standards, and any relevant modern awards.
  • Own the maintenance and periodic review of People & Culture policies and procedures, keeping them current, compliant with applicable legislation, and accessible to everyone across the region.
  • Support Workplace Health and Safety obligations, including psychosocial safety, and manage return to work and workers’ compensation cases in line with applicable legislation and 3P policy.
  • Maintain and optimise our HRIS (BambooHR) and internal systems, ensuring data integrity, functionality, and relevance.
  • Prepare people reports and generate insights to inform decisions on hiring, turnover, engagement, and diversity.
  • Champion culture initiatives and events that strengthen connection and collaboration across teams, making 3P an inclusive and genuinely great place to work.
  • Collaborate on cross-functional projects and global P&C initiatives as they arise.

What you'll bring: 

  • Solid experience in a People & Culture, HR Advisor, or related generalist role, ideally gained in a fast-paced and varied environment.
  • Solid working knowledge of Australian employment legislation, including the Fair Work Act, National Employment Standards, and modern award interpretation.
  • A good working knowledge of Workplace Health and Safety obligations including psychosocial safety, and experience managing return to work and workers’ compensation cases as the need arises.
  • Experience owning or contributing to People & Culture policy development and maintenance.
  • Proficiency with HRIS platforms (BambooHR a plus) and Microsoft Office; comfortable extracting and using data to generate meaningful insights.
  • A track record of building trusted relationships with managers and employees at all levels.
  • A proactive and solutions-focused mindset, calm under pressure, discreet with sensitive matters, and demonstrates solid judgement in knowing when to escalate.
  • Strong communication skills, clear, empathetic, and confident – adaptive to the context and circumstances.
  • A genuine curiosity and drive to continuously improve processes and the employee experience.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
